>> I forgot to mention that my other problem with Melbourne's public
>> transport was the lack of 24 hour running.  Even in Newcastle, I can
>> catch a train home at 4 in the morning after a night out, whereas in
>> Melbourne, it was time to shell out a cab fee home.
> 
> Don't see it happening under the current contracts. All timetable changes
> implemented so far, including those about to hit in the next week or so,
> are all part of the operators contracts - i.e. don't implement these
> timetable changes, and you'll cop a fine. 24 hour running is not in the
> contracts.
> 
> M.

At least bayside trains have increased the Sunday finishing time for the
trains from the ridiculous 11:30pm to midnight to line up with the rest of
the week.  They are now running later, just not much later.
